The quickest way to profit at that budget, however, is a kiosk retail shop in a mall.  For fun, you could try novelty sex items.  That's good for a kiosk because it rarely justifies a whole store in a mall...

Depends on your location though.  In New York, for example, there are big franchises for that sort of thing, and you wouldn't last at a kiosk.

Running a business is, in and of itself, enjoyable if you like being your own boss.  You can always put your best effort into the areas you enjoy, and hire people for the rest.

At $1000, you could do anything. 

Some businesses don't require a lot of money.

For example, consulting, real estate, and job placement firms can all be started from home, easily and with little/no overhead over normal living costs.

By the simple expedient of fitting a phono pre-amp in-line between a
turntable and the line input of my computer sound-card, I now have the
capacity to transfer vinyl to CDROM or DVD. (Investment $30.00)

A further investment of $30 acquired for me an incredible program called
Magix Audio Cleaning Lab which is astonishingly effective at removing snaps,
crackles, pops and rumble - in fact quite considerable digital remastering
is not only possible but very easy to perform.

So far I have transcribed two recordings; Pablo Casals RCA 1951 and Kathleen
Ferrier Decca 1960.

The results are better than the original!

Cold canvassing has revealed that many people have favorite vinyl recordings
that they would be prepared to pay about $10 each to have transcribed.

Work from home with minimal overhead! Listen to rare old recordings and add
them to your collection! Seems too good to be true - but so far I can't find
a hole in it. A nice little pot-boiler to provide an urgently needed pension
scheme I'm thinking...
